之前更改过homebrew-core源,今天忽然发现我用brew config命令查看的源是github的,但是用cd "$(brew --repo homebrew/core)" && git remote -v命令查看却是中科大源,shell用的是zsh,zshrc文件也配置过了,也重新加载过文件了,请问为什么这两者展示的源不一样?我现在的源又到底是哪一个?
config命令:
另一个命令:
小魔女参考了bing和GPT部分内容调写:
可能是因为你之前修改过Homebrew-core源,但是没有把修改的源更新到zshrc文件中,导致brew config命令展示的源是github的,而cd "$(brew --repo homebrew/core)”&& git remote -v命令查看的源是中科大源。
要想确定你当前的源,可以用brew config命令查看,如果不是你想要的源,可以使用以下命令来更改:
brew tap homebrew/core
cd "$(brew --repo homebrew/core)"
git remote set-url origin https://mirrors.ustc.edu.cn/brew.git
上述命令会将Homebrew-core源更改为中科大源,并且把更改的源更新到zshrc文件中,这样就可以保证brew config命令和cd "$(brew --repo homebrew/core)”&& git remote -v命令查看的源一致了。
回答不易,记得采纳呀。